Subido por Miguel Santos

DETALLEACTIVIDAD2 (2)

Anuncio
ADMINISTRACIÓN DE BASE DE DATOS
Ana E. Congacha., Ing.
UNIDAD 2: TRANSACCIONES
Propiedades ACID, procesamiento, consideraciones para su uso.
ACTIVIDAD
1. Estudiar y practicar cada uno de los temas que constan en el material adjunto en el aula
virtual: Unidad II: Transacciones – EVALUACIÓN DE UNIDAD (30-08-2021)
2. En equipo de 7 personas, resolver el siguiente ejercicio:
Utilizando transacciones realizar una transferencia de los datos de la tabla ASPIRANTE a la tabla
ESTUDIANTE.
1. El Aspirante es un Estudiante cuando alcanza una nota >=8 en el examen de admisión.
2. Cambiar el estado del Aspirante de: NO ACEPTADO ha ACEPTADO (al cumplir el punto 1)
3. En ESTUDIANTE también almacenar la fecha en la que se realiza esta asignación.
Partimos de:
ASPIRANTE
idAspirante
1
2
3
nombre
juan
María
Carlos
apellido
Pérez
López
Sánchez
fechaNacimiento
2000-09-07
2000-05-08
1999-09-07
notaAdmision
null
null
null
estado
NO ACEPTADO
NO ACEPTADO
NO ACEPTADO
fechaNacimiento
2000-09-07
2000-05-08
1999-09-07
notaAdmision
9
6
null
estado
ACEPTADO
NO ACEPTADO
NO ACEPTADO
Al ingresar la nota de Admisión:
ASPIRANTE
idAspirante
1
2
3
nombre
juan
María
Carlos
ESTUDIANTE
idEstudiante
1
apellido
Pérez
López
Sánchez
nombre
juan
apellido
Pérez
fechaNacimiento
2000-09-07
1
fechaAsignacion
2021-08-27
ADMINISTRACIÓN DE BASE DE DATOS
Ana E. Congacha., Ing.
3. El archivo a entregar tendrá el siguiente formato:
a. Tipo de archivo: .sql
4. Un representante del equipo adjunta el archivo.
RUBRICA
CRITERIOS
PUNTUACIÒN
DESCRIPCIÓN



FORMA
Organización
---

FONDO
Ejercicio
3
Total
3
Formato indicado.
Adjuntar el archivo en el aula virtual (no
links).
El no cumplimiento de los puntos
anteriores se penalizará con -0,5
En el script colocar el nombre de los
integrantes
Trabajos idénticos se penalizará con una
nota de 0,3
Objetivo Transacción
Uso correcto de try- catch
¡Nos vemos…pronto!
2
Descargar